Just walking into the sleek, ultra trendy Electric Bar and Restaurant in Lincoln will do to take your breath away. Exuding retro-style and sophistication, this venue may be the perfect place to entertain family, friends or colleagues. Those searching for a romantic night out won't be disappointed as the airy dining space offers plenty of room for more intimate meals, and weather permitting the balcony tables offer stunning views over the city. Its 5th-floor location at the DoubleTree by Hilton creates a perfect location for anyone visiting the city, not to mention the views across the Brayford Wharf and Marina are outstanding.

The a la carte menu begins with an array of tantalizing starters such as for example pan seared scallops with pea parfait, texture of pea, mint yoghurt, cucumber and beer battered scraps or the rich and hearty Cullen skink with confit potato, egg, smoked haddock and fish veloute. The pan roasted pigeon breast with golden beetroot, beetroot ketchup, pickled beetroot, orange, watercress and juniper salt is really a popular choice while vegetarian can benefit from the Jerusalem artichoke risotto with truffle foam and an artichoke crisp.

At the Electric Bar and Restaurant expect to see sea trout with air dried parma ham, tomato and red pepper, mixed bean cassoulet and samphire or light, flakey plaice fillets with mussels, diced confit potato, broad bean and spinach, chantrelle mushroom and shell fish foam. Those wanting something a little meatier can enjoy rack of lamb with lambs liver, boulangere potato, pea and mint puree, cauliflower cheese, chargrilled spring onion, confit tomato and port jus. Of course an array of local Lincolnshire beef can be acquired and guests can choose from fillet, sirloin, rib eye and rump cooked with their preference and served with peppercorn, wild mushroom or B�arnaise sauce. To complete diners are spoilt for choice with chocolate truffle torte, lemon parfait, profiteroles or rhubarb and stem ginger crumble.
